Heating System Repair

If a furnace stops heating the house during colder weather, the situation can quickly become stressful. Some systems shut down entirely, leaving the house cold within hours. Others keep running but struggle to produce enough heat to reach all areas of the house. When the team at Harold HVAC Services in St. Martins, MO examines a furnace, we start by observing how the unit behaves during a full cycle. Does it start normally? Does the flame remain steady? Does the blower continue pushing warm air long enough to properly warm the home? By watching the system operate step by step, our experts can identify the part that is causing the disruption. After the problematic part is fixed, the furnace can return to producing steady heat again. Before finishing the visit, the unit is tested through several more cycles to ensure that the home is warming evenly again.

Air Conditioning Repair

Cooling systems tend to reveal problems gradually. Initially, you may see that the home feels a bit warmer than normal even though the thermostat hasnt changed. The unit continues operating, but the home never fully cools down. Sometimes, the system may start producing strange sounds or turning off suddenly during the peak heat hours. Cooling units include different sections where problems may arise like the outdoor condenser, the indoor evaporator coil, wiring and electrical components, refrigerant circulation, and airflow through the duct network. With Harold HVAC Services in St. Martins, MO, our team inspect every part closely during a service call. By tracing how the system moves heat out of the home, they can determine where the cooling process is being interrupted. After the fault is resolved, the system should return to its normal rhythm of steadily cooling the home without operating longer than it should.

HVAC System Installation

Every heating and cooling unit comes to a stage where continued repairs no longer make sense. The unit can still operate, but breakdowns become more frequent and efficiency begins to decline. Upgrading the unit provides a chance to install equipment that matches the needs of the house more closely. Before recommending a replacement system, the team at Harold HVAC Services in St. Martins, MO evaluates the layout of the home. Square footage, insulation levels, air circulation, and the design of the ductwork all play a role in how a heating and cooling system should be selected. Choosing equipment that fits these conditions helps avoid unnecessary strain on the system or turning on and off too often. After installation gets underway, each component of the system is connected and calibrated so that the equipment operates smoothly within the house layout.

Routine HVAC Maintenance

Heating and cooling units operate through long seasons of heavy use. In the summer months, the cooling system often runs for long stretches. During winter, the heater turns on and off frequently to sustain indoor comfort. Without occasional maintenance, dust and wear gradually affect the performance of these systems. Routine service visits allow technicians to examine the equipment before major faults occur. Air filters are inspected, moving components are inspected, and ventilation is assessed. Maintenance appointments often reveal minor problems like unsecured wiring or early signs of wear that can be corrected before they grow into larger repairs. Ductwork Inspection and Repair

Ductwork distributes conditioned air throughout the property, yet it often remains hidden behind walls, ceilings, or basement structures. Because it is out of sight, problems can develop without immediate notice. Small leaks along the ducts may allow cooled or heated air to escape before reaching the targeted spaces. Accumulated dust or minor blockages can also reduce airflow. When the team at Harold HVAC Services in St. Martins, MO assesses air ducts, the goal is to determine airflow patterns. Points where air flow drops or leaks are fixed so the system can distribute air evenly again. Enhanced airflow often improves overall system performance.

St. Martins or Saint Martins is a city in Cole County, Missouri, United States. The population was 1,191 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Jefferson City, Missouri Metropolitan Statistical Area.
